			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p align="justify">Vision Helpdesk creates a logical separation across staff &amp; clients of various  domains/companies.</p>
<p>Vision helpdesk is true satellite helpdesk which allows you to add n number of companies and manage them all at single place with ease..</p>
<p><strong>How does Satellite helpdesk feature  works ?</strong></p>
<p>To illustrate this we will take an example of managing two companies which can be extended to any number..</p>
<p>We have added two companies in our demo. Both domains are  hosted on <span style="color: #ff6600;">physically different servers. (You can host on same server too )</span></p>
<p><strong>Company One </strong>:  http://visiononlinedemo.com/</p>
<p><strong>Company Two</strong> : <a href="http://iamdemo.com/">http://iamdemo.com/</a><br style="line-height: 15px;" /></p>
<p>Vision setup needs to be installed on just one domain — In our case we have  installed on Company One :  <a class="style19" href="http://www.visiononlinedemo.com/support/manage/" target="_blank">http://www.visiononlinedemo.com/support/manage/</a></p>
<p>Vision Database will be on server one — <span style="color: #ff6600;">this database needs to have remote access enabled (If second domain is on different server other wise if both domains are on same server then no need to add remote connection to database)</span></p>
<p><span style="color: #ff6600;">While Company two needs just client portal files. (No installation setup  required for company two)</span></p>

<p>On server one you need to create pipe (you can also use pop/ imap, choice is  your’s ) for support, sales and billing.</p>
<p>support@<a href="mailto:support@visiononlinedemo.com">visiononlinedemo.com</a>: “|/full_path_to/manage/pipe.php”<br />
sales@<a href="mailto:support@visiononlinedemo.com">visiononlinedemo.com</a>:”|/full_path_to/manage/pipe.php”<br />
billing@<a href="mailto:support@visiononlinedemo.com">visiononlinedemo.com</a>: “|/full_path_to/manage/pipe.php”</p>
<p><span style="color: #ff6600;">On server two forward support and <a href="mailto:sales@iamdemo.com">sales@iamdemo.com</a> to <a href="mailto:support@visiononlinedemo.com">support@visiononlinedemo.com</a></span></p>

<p><strong>Vision helpdesk setup needs to be installed on all companies ? </strong></p>
<p>NO, just on one company domain you need to install vision setup and on rest domains you need to just upload client portal files.</p>
